Form 4: ACNB Corp Director Alexandra C. Chiaruttini Reports Acquisition and Disposal of Shares

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Director Alexandra C. Chiaruttini reports acquiring shares of ACNB Corp through director compensation and dividend reinvestment, while also disposing of shares.

Summary

  • On March 14, 2025, Alexandra C. Chiaruttini, a director of ACNB Corp, reported transactions involving ACNB Corporation Common stock.
  • She acquired 190.7935 shares as compensation for her service as a director at a price of $41.275 per share.
  • She also disposed of 2,121.4554 shares.
  • Following these transactions, Chiaruttini beneficially owns 2,121.4554 shares of ACNB Corporation Common stock.
  • Some shares were acquired through the automatic reinvestment of dividends under the ACNB Corporation Dividend Reinvestment and Stock Purchase Plan.

Industry Context

Form 4 filings are a routine part of corporate governance, providing transparency into the transactions of company insiders. Investors often monitor these filings to gain insights into management's perspective on the company's stock.
